Β£500m Thames Water desalination plant has provided just seven days’ water over 15 years Plant in Beckton has run only five times and has been beset by multiple problems since it was built

"That puts the lifetime bill at about Β£518m, or about 7p for every litre the plant has ever produced, which is 28 times more than customers usually pay for their water." We need public ownership of water NOW!!! @weownit.org.uk @riveractionuk.bsky.social www.theguardian.com/business/202...

UK public has paid Β£200bn to shareholders of key industries since privatisation Analysis reveals β€˜privatisation premium’ of Β£250 per household per year paid to owners of water, rail, bus, energy and mail services since 2010

"... the privatised water industry, which has run up long-term debts of Β£73bn and paid out dividends of Β£88.4bn in the past 34 years at the same time as overseeing record sewage spills." @weownit.org.uk @riveractionuk.bsky.social www.theguardian.com/politics/202...
